中文摘要
随着我国经济进入高质量发展阶段,制造业提质增效的重要性愈发凸显,建立并推广制造业绿色增长模式不仅是国家建设“制造强国”的战略需要,也是行业突破资源环境约束实现跨越发展的必然趋势,更是企业成功转型升级的源动力。因此,立足于高质量发展阶段的基本特征与具体要求,构建有效的制造业绿色增长动力机制,选择科学可行的实现路径成为学术界和管理实践领域急需解决的问题。本研究拟从系统解析高质量发展阶段制造业绿色增长的概念和内涵出发,明晰高质量发展阶段制造业绿色增长核心主体及关键动因,构建多主体协同的制造业绿色增长动力机制,揭示以高质量发展为目标导向的制造业绿色增长实现路径的动态演化特征与规律,并提出相应的保障动力机制和实现路径有效实施的对策建议。本研究提出的动力机制及实现路径不仅可补充完善高质量发展与绿色增长的理论,也为我国制造业的可持续发展提供理论借鉴和实践指导。
英文摘要
As China’s economy enters the high-quality development stage, the importance of improving the quality and efficiency of manufacturing industry has become increasingly prominent. Establishing and promoting the green growth model of manufacturing is not only the strategic need for building a strong manufacturing country, but also the inevitable trend for achieving industrial leapfrog development to break through the constraints of resources and environment, and the source power for enterprises’ successful transformation and upgrading. Therefore, based on the basic characteristics and specific requirements of the high-quality development stage, constructing an effective dynamic mechanism of manufacturing green growth and choosing a scientific and feasible implementation path have become an urgent problem solved in academia and management practice. This study starts from the systematic analysis of concepts and connotations of manufacturing green growth in the high-quality development stage, and clarifies the core participants of that and their key motivations. The dynamic mechanism of manufacturing green growth based on multi-agent synergy is set up, the dynamic evolution characteristics and laws of implementation paths with high-quality development as the goal are uncovered, and countermeasures are put forward to ensure mechanism and path running smoothly. The dynamic mechanism and implementation paths proposed in this study can not only complement and improve the theories of high-quality development and green growth, but also provide theoretical reference and practical guidance for the sustainable development of China’s manufacturing industry.
